Anegundi
Anegundi is a small village located on the northern bank of the Tungabhadra River, just 5 km from Hampi. This ancient village is believed to be the birthplace of Lord Hanuman and is home to several ancient temples and ruins. Visit the Anjanadri Hill, which offers stunning views of the surrounding landscape.

Daroji Sloth Bear Sanctuary
The Daroji Sloth Bear Sanctuary is a must-visit for nature lovers and wildlife enthusiasts. Located about 15 km from Hampi, this sanctuary is home to a large population of sloth bears, as well as other wildlife species such as leopards, hyenas, and monkeys. Tungabhadra Dam
The Tungabhadra Dam is a massive dam located about 15 km from Hampi. This dam is built across the Tungabhadra River and offers stunning views of the surrounding landscape. Take a boat ride on the reservoir or simply relax in the scenic surroundings.
Badami
Badami is a historic town located about 150 km from Hampi. This town is known for its stunning rock-cut temples, which date back to the 6th century. Visit the Badami Cave Temples, which are dedicated to Lord Shiva, Vishnu, and Jain deities. Don’t miss the stunning views of the Agastya Lake.
Pattadakal
Pattadakal is a small village located about 140 km from Hampi. This village is known for its stunning temples, which are a blend of Dravidian and Nagara styles of architecture. Visit the Pattadakal Temple Complex, which is a UNESCO World Heritage Site.
Aihole
Aihole is a historic town located about 120 km from Hampi. This town is known for its ancient temples, which date back to the 5th century. Visit the Aihole Temple Complex, which is home to over 125 temples, including the famous Durga Temple.

How far is Anegundi from Hampi, and what are the transportation options?
Anegundi is approximately 5 km from Hampi and can be reached by auto-rickshaws, bicycles, or on foot. The journey takes around 15-20 minutes by auto-rickshaw and 30-40 minutes by bicycle. What is the best time to visit nearby places around Hampi?
The best time to visit nearby places around Hampi is from October to February, when the weather is pleasant and comfortable. This is the ideal time to explore the outdoors and enjoy the scenic beauty of the region. Avoid visiting during the summer months (March to May) as the temperature can be extremely hot.
